我們還需要焚化爐嗎?
Do We Still Need An Incinerator? (2001)
DV 40mins Pal Hong Kong Cantonese without subtitles
A video project for GreenPeace Hong Kong about the local activism against the building of a harmful incinerator in Tuen Mun. It is also a video for the general public on recycling.
